About Jun‐Liang Zeng
Jun‐Liang Zeng is a scholar working on Pharmaceutical Science, Organic Chemistry and Polymers and Plastics, having authored 18 papers that have together received 539 indexed citations. Recurring topics across this work include Fluorine in Organic Chemistry (10 papers), Cyclopropane Reaction Mechanisms (6 papers) and Click Chemistry and Applications (4 papers). The work is most often cited by research in Pharmaceutical Science (261 citations), Organic Chemistry (439 citations) and Inorganic Chemistry (73 citations). Jun‐Liang Zeng has collaborated with scholars based in China and France. Frequent co-authors include Jun‐An Ma, Zhen Chen, Fa‐Guang Zhang, Jing Nie, Yan Zheng, Lijun Yang, Shuai Wang, Dominique Cahard, Yue Zhang and Heng‐Ying Xiong. Their work appears in journals such as Electrochimica Acta, The Journal of Organic Chemistry and Chemistry - A European Journal.
